Top Online Courses to Boost Your Career in 2025

Top Online Courses to Boost Your Career in 2025

June Hays2025-01-02T16:20:56+00:00

In today’s fast-changing job market, staying competitive means continually updating your skills. Online courses provide a flexible and accessible way to learn new skills or deepen your expertise. This guide explores some of the best online courses for career advancement in 2025, covering fields like technology, business, communication, and more.

Why Online Learning Matters

Online education has grown immensely, with millions of professionals turning to platforms like Coursera, Udemy, and LinkedIn Learning. The e-learning market is projected to reach $374 billion by 2026 (Statista). This trend reflects the demand for flexible, self-paced learning solutions that fit busy schedules.

Whether you’re looking to enter a new field or enhance your current skill set, these courses can help bridge gaps and make you more competitive in the job market.

1. Technology and Data Science

a. Python for Everybody (Coursera)

  • Instructor: Dr. Charles Severance
  • What You’ll Learn: Programming fundamentals, data structures, and Python applications.
  • Why It’s Valuable: Python remains one of the most in-demand programming languages. Learning Python can open doors to careers in data analysis, software development, and artificial intelligence.

b. Data Science Specialization (edX)

  • Provider: Harvard University
  • What You’ll Learn: Data analysis, visualization, and machine learning.
  • Why It’s Valuable: Data-driven decision-making is crucial in today’s business landscape. This course equips learners with the tools to work with large datasets and derive insights.

c. Cloud Computing (AWS Academy)

  • What You’ll Learn: Cloud architecture, AWS services, and deployment strategies.
  • Why It’s Valuable: Cloud computing skills are in high demand across industries, with AWS being one of the most widely used platforms.

2. Business and Management

a. Strategic Leadership and Management (Coursera)

  • Provider: University of Illinois
  • What You’ll Learn: Leadership theories, strategic planning, and organizational dynamics.
  • Why It’s Valuable: Effective leadership drives business success. This course is designed for aspiring managers and executives.

b. Financial Modeling and Valuation (Udemy)

  • What You’ll Learn: Building financial models, understanding company valuation, and using Excel for finance.
  • Why It’s Valuable: These skills are essential for careers in finance, investment banking, and corporate strategy.

c. Marketing in a Digital World (Coursera)

  • Provider: University of Illinois
  • What You’ll Learn: Digital marketing strategies, customer behavior analysis, and branding.
  • Why It’s Valuable: Digital marketing is integral to modern business, and this course provides practical insights into leveraging online platforms.

3. Communication and Soft Skills

a. Business Communication (LinkedIn Learning)

  • What You’ll Learn: Professional writing, presentation skills, and interpersonal communication.
  • Why It’s Valuable: Clear communication can enhance workplace relationships and career progression.

b. Negotiation Mastery (Harvard Business School Online)

  • What You’ll Learn: Negotiation strategies, conflict resolution, and building agreements.
  • Why It’s Valuable: Negotiation skills are critical for securing deals, resolving conflicts, and achieving career goals.

c. Emotional Intelligence at Work (edX)

  • Provider: University of California, Berkeley
  • What You’ll Learn: Emotional awareness, empathy, and effective leadership.
  • Why It’s Valuable: Emotional intelligence fosters better teamwork, leadership, and decision-making.

4. Industry-Specific Skills

a. Introduction to Healthcare Analytics (Coursera)

  • Provider: Georgia Institute of Technology
  • What You’ll Learn: Healthcare data analysis, predictive modeling, and decision-making.
  • Why It’s Valuable: With the growing digitization of healthcare, analytics professionals are in demand to improve patient outcomes and operational efficiency.

b. UX/UI Design Fundamentals (Udemy)

  • What You’ll Learn: User experience principles, interface design, and prototyping tools like Figma.
  • Why It’s Valuable: As technology evolves, companies need skilled UX/UI designers to create user-friendly applications and websites.

c. Green Energy Solutions (edX)

  • Provider: Delft University of Technology
  • What You’ll Learn: Renewable energy technologies, sustainability practices, and energy policy.
  • Why It’s Valuable: Sustainability is a growing priority, and expertise in green energy can lead to impactful careers.

5. Certifications That Stand Out

a. Google Career Certificates

  • Offered By: Google
  • Fields Covered: IT support, project management, data analytics, and UX design.
  • Why It’s Valuable: These affordable, industry-recognized certificates can be completed in under six months, offering a fast track to entry-level roles.

b. PMP Certification (Project Management Institute)

  • What You’ll Learn: Project planning, execution, and monitoring.
  • Why It’s Valuable: The PMP is a gold standard for project managers, recognized globally.

c. Certified Ethical Hacker (CEH)

  • What You’ll Learn: Cybersecurity tools, penetration testing, and ethical hacking techniques.
  • Why It’s Valuable: With cybersecurity threats on the rise, this certification is crucial for IT professionals.

Tips for Choosing the Right Course

  1. Assess Your Career Goals: Identify the skills needed for your desired roles.
  2. Check Credibility: Look for courses from reputable institutions or platforms.
  3. Read Reviews: Learn from the experiences of previous participants.
  4. Consider Your Schedule: Opt for courses that offer flexibility, such as self-paced options.
  5. Budget Wisely: Many platforms offer free trials or affordable pricing plans.
